General Camp Information

This year George is focused on his 10 Point Theory, Lion Preditor Theory. 10 arm qualities required are dead, connect/not connect, spiritual, delay, melt, shrink while body expands, conditioning... Basic training throughout the camp will be drawn from Chen style Taiji, Xing-Yi, Bagua, Tongbei. Participants practicing any form are welcome and will benefit from the internal training applicable to all styles. The main focus of this camp is on the melting of the structure, creating superior ground force or vertical zhong ding, gravity, whole body one unit connection, space power, superior power all the time against enemy no concave no convex, practice volume not line, practice spiritual not physical and down replace up. We will do qigong, a lot of two person testing, two person drills and applications, push hands.

Lodging: The facilities include a meditation hall converted from a turn-of-the-century redwood barn with pinewood flooring (30’x 40’), surrounded by redwood decks, a cozy dining room (16’ x 26’), a large spacious yurt (30’ diameter), a smaller yurt (20’ diameter), a beautiful restroom/bath house-uniquely inspired by the art of Japanese joinery, and several rustic cabins. Bedding is provided. We will have a minimum of 15 people and a maximum of 30. The camp housing is segregated and although we will try, we can cannot guarantee couples' cohabitation.

Food: Three delicious, mostly vegetarian meals will be provided daily. Participants must provide their own specialty food for unusual diets and food allergies.

Master Lu Gui Rong, push hands and Yang Tai Chi Master, taught in 2001; Wu Style Grandmaster Wang Hao Da  taught from 1996-2000; have taught with  Master George Xu, one of the top U.S. Chen teachers and Lan Shou experts, and who has produced this camp for over twenty years.
